如何使用jQuery实现方法按顺序执行
引言
作为一名经验丰富的开发者,我们经常需要使用jQuery来简化前端开发过程。其中一个常见的需求就是让一系列方法按照特定的顺序执行。在本文中,我将向你展示如何使用jQuery来实现这一功能。首先,我们需要了解整个流程,然后逐步实现每一步所需的代码。
流程概述
首先,让我们通过甘特图来展示这个过程的整体流程:
gantt
title jQuery方法按顺序执行流程
section 定义方法
第一步: 定义方法 :a1, 2022-10-10, 2d
section 按顺序执行方法
第二步: 按顺序执行方法 :b1, after a1, 2d
section 结束
第三步: 结束 :c1, after b1, 2d
具体步骤及代码
第一步: 定义方法
在这一步,我们需要定义一系列需要按顺序执行的方法。
```javascript
// 方法一
function method1() {
console.log('方法一执行');
}
// 方法二
function method2() {
console.log('方法二执行');
}
// 方法三
function method3() {
console.log('方法三执行');
}
### 第二步: 按顺序执行方法
接下来,我们需要使用jQuery来按照我们定义的顺序执行这些方法。
```markdown
```javascript
// 使用jQuery的Deferred对象
var deferred = $.Deferred();
// 顺序执行方法
deferred
.done(method1) // 执行方法一
.done(method2) // 执行方法二
.done(method3); // 执行方法三
// 解决Deferred对象
deferred.resolve();
### 第三步: 结束
在这一步,我们已经成功地按照定义的顺序执行了这些方法。你可以在控制台中看到这些方法按照顺序依次执行的结果。
## 结论
通过本文的介绍,你已经学会了如何使用jQuery来实现方法按顺序执行的功能。记住,使用Deferred对象可以帮助我们轻松地按照定义的顺序执行方法。希望这篇文章对你有所帮助,祝你在前端开发的道路上越走越远!